Black-ish star Tracee Ellis Ross has praised the decision by several NBA teams to strike over the Wisconsin police shooting of Jacob Blake earlier this week.

The Milwaukee Bucks, an NBA team located around an hour outside of Kenosha, where Blake was shot, never appeared on the court for their playoff game against the Orlando Magic Wednesday night.

Following the news of the Bucks' strike, the five remaining playoff teams, including the Magic, joined them in postponing their games, with Los Angeles' two teams, the Lakers and Clippers, voting to strike for the remainder of the season later in the day.
